Facilities Ticket — Cleaning Crew Access, Brindle Annex

For new starters handling evening lock-up: the Sorano Cleaning crew arrives nightly at 21:30 via the annex side door. Check their rota sheet, note arrival in the log, and ensure the storeroom is relocked afterward. To let them through the side door, enter the access code below.

badge for yaweg-hafog: bdg-GX-6

## Changelog — Ticktrace 1.9

### Renamed: DRIFT_API_TOKEN
During the cron drift investigation we found plugins confusing this variable with the metrics token, so it has been renamed to indicate it authorizes drift-report uploads specifically. Plugin authors must read the new name from 1.9 onward; the old name is ignored without warning. Sample env files in the SDK are updated. In your deployment env file, the drift-report upload secret is set on the next line.

env line for fawef-taguf: VAULT_KEY13=a9695905a9a90

CI failures on the Proctorline exam-proctoring queue: flaky when the mock session broker starts slower than 5s. Symptom: `queue_drain_test` times out, everything else green. Fix is not to bump the timeout — that hides real drain regressions. Instead, ensure the broker fixture uses the pinned image; unpinned pulls added ~8s cold start. If it reproduces locally, clear the fixture cache and rerun. Escalate only if the drain test fails with the pinned image. Tag any escalation with the trace token directly below.

pipeline stamp: htk31_f769b577b3028a4e9958e5bb8d1259a

Hey — welcome aboard! Quick drift ticket for you. The connection pool settings on the Lanternfish API nodes have wandered from what's in our baseline repo. Someone hand-tweaked pool sizes on two boxes during the outage last month and never backported the changes, so now staging and prod disagree and we're seeing intermittent pool exhaustion. First task: compare each node against the canonical config and flag anything off. For reference, the intended values we deploy everywhere are listed below.

config for kagup-hahig:
druwyn:
  pin: 2801
  metrics_host: metrics.druwyn.zemvarlabs.internal
  tenant: sorius
  seal: seal_798a43d7